Episode Four: In the Middle of Crenshaw and Watts

View descriptionShare

While the Laker franchise tries to heal after their sixth loss to the Celtics in the Finals, the city of Los Angeles tries to heal in the wake of the Watts Rebellion. Amidst the racial strife, the league suffers with both sponsors and national relevance. Owner Jack Kent Cooke then makes the trade that changes the landscape of the NBA when his Lakers acquire Wilt Chamberlain. But the team’s championship plans are thwarted once again by their East Coast nemesis, the Boston Celtics.
